    this 39 Nash was purchased by legendary car builder Joe Wilhelm in 1945 and was his first Custom. He owned this car up until the late 60s and it's been sitting ever since. Not much is known about the car but the front end treatment was done in the mid 50s which he emulated on the famous Jaguar royale for Andy Anderson. So far I've only been able to come up with one old photo from the 1940s. At this time he had just lowered it and had molded the fenders. I'm told that Joe's widow should have more photos of the car going back to the 1940s especially because they use this car on their honeymoon. But I have no idea how to get a hold of her. The car was confirmed to be Joe's by Bruce Glasscock. Bruce knew Joe pretty well and remembered the car. This is a radical Custom with a heavy chop, channeled, everything molded and shaved. Currently sits on some sort of Chevelle or Nova chassis and has a small block Chevy under the hood. I have no idea what the condition of the motor is but I assume that it does not run.
